Photovoltaic array foundations mainly include concrete embedded parts foundations, concrete counterweight block foundations, spiral ground pile foundations, directly embedded foundations, concrete prefabricated pile foundations and ground anchor foundations. What are the causes of photovoltaic panel fires

What are the causes of photovoltaic panel fires

Top 10 PV fire causes: faulty connectors, DC isolators, loose links, bad diodes, cable damage, hotspots, poor design, roof spread, debris, weak grounding. . While the overall fire risk is extremely low, understanding what causes solar panels to catch fire is crucial for protecting your property and maximizing your investment. Several factors can lead to overheating, short circuits, or electrical faults that ignite fires in solar systems.
